what is hydrophily?
pollination of flowers by the agent of water is known as hydrophily

- Hydrophily is pollination of flowers by means of water. Example Zostera. When pollination occurs by water in the plants floating on the surface of the water, it is called Ephydrophily. ... Hence, hydrophily occurs in Vallisneria and Zostera.
